Java笔试代码提交及样本分析

需积分: 5 0 下载量 151 浏览量 更新于2024-11-04 收藏 917B ZIP 举报
涉及的知识点 1. Java基础知识:Java是一种广泛使用的编程语言,以其“编写一次,到处运行”的特性著称。Java代码通常包含类、方法和属性,其中main方法是程序的入口点。在笔试中,Java代码的提交样本可能涉及对基础语法的掌握,比如数据类型、控制流程、异常处理、集合框架等。 2. 编程问题解决能力:笔试中提交的Java代码通常是为了展示应聘者解决特定问题的能力。这可能包括算法设计、数据结构的使用、面向对象编程的应用等。应聘者需要通过编写有效、可读和高效的代码来展示其问题解决能力。 3. 代码规范和风格:良好的代码编写习惯对于维护和团队协作至关重要。代码样本应遵循Java编程规范,如变量命名约定、合理的缩进、注释的使用等,这些都是评估应聘者代码质量的重要指标。 4. 项目结构组织:了解如何组织项目文件对于笔试也是重要的,尤其是当笔试题目要求提交的代码包含多个文件时。例如,一个简单的Java项目可能包含主类(main.java),以及可能的资源文件、配置文件等。README.txt文件通常用于提供项目说明,指导如何构建和运行程序。 5. Java开发环境配置:笔试代码提交前,应聘者需要确保他们的开发环境正确配置。这包括安装了JDK(Java Development Kit),配置了环境变量,了解如何编译和运行Java代码。在实际工作中,熟悉集成开发环境(IDE)如IntelliJ IDEA或Eclipse也是十分必要的。 6. 代码调试和测试:在笔试中,应聘者可能需要在有限的时间内调试代码,并确保代码提交前能够通过所有测试用例。这不仅需要对Java语言的深入理解,还需要一定的调试技巧。 7. 版本控制和代码提交:在实际的开发工作中,代码提交通常伴随着版本控制系统的使用,如Git。虽然本次文件列表中没有提供版本控制相关的文件,但了解如何使用版本控制系统进行代码的提交、版本的管理和分支的切换是现代开发工作中的重要技能。 8. 算法和数据结构:由于Java是一种通用编程语言,应聘者可能需要使用Java实现各种算法和数据结构,这可能是笔试考核的重点。例如,笔试可能会要求使用Java实现排序算法、树结构、图算法等。 9. 面向对象设计原则:笔试中可能会考核应聘者对面向对象设计原则的理解,如封装、继承、多态等,以及如何在实际代码中正确应用这些原则来编写可复用和可扩展的代码。 10. 问题理解能力:提交代码前,应聘者首先需要准确理解题目要求,包括输入输出格式、功能需求、性能要求等。这是编写有效代码的前提,也是笔试考核的重点之一。 总结来说,"java代码-笔试代码提交sample" 文件集合向我们展示了在笔试环境下,应聘者需要具备的一系列Java编程技能和知识。从基础知识到问题解决能力,从代码规范到项目组织,再到代码调试和版本控制,一个成功的Java程序员需要在多个维度上都有所掌握。此外,理解题目要求和具备面向对象设计的能力也是不可或缺的。
2025-02-16 上传